Your thoughts do not reflect reality. Intrusive thoughts are often absolutely horrible thoughts we would not think willingly. I used to get them really bad and therapy/medication are great resources but unfortunately I can't do that at this moment. It came with time but educating myself on OCD and intrusive thoughts helped and it's not easy but when you get an intrusive thought, remind yourself it's just an intrusive thought. Don't try to forcefully shove it out of your brain, try not to feel any shame when one happens and I like to laugh and make fun of it like, "You're an intrusive thought. You're not reality and you can't hurt me." and it fades away. But again, that does take time.
